Imagine you’ve purchased phone cases from Shenzhen, toys from Yiwu, and clothing from Guangzhou. Shipping each order separately would mean three different customs clearances, higher freight charges, and wasted time. This is where China freight consolidation becomes the smart solution—combining multiple shipments into one streamlined process.
In this guide, we’ll explain freight consolidation, compare costs, show how it benefits SMEs and e-commerce sellers, and help you choose the right China freight forwarder for reliable consolidation services.
Why Businesses Use China Freight Consolidation Services
- Multiple Suppliers, One Shipment – Common in e-commerce sourcing.
- Cost Efficiency – Reduces per-unit freight costs.
- Simplified Documentation – One Bill of Lading instead of many.
- Reduced Customs Complexity – Smooth clearance with consolidated paperwork.
Key Benefits of Freight Consolidation from China
Lower Shipping Costs
Instead of shipping multiple small LCL shipments separately, consolidation allows you to pay less per CBM.
Simplified Customs Clearance
With a single set of documents, customs procedures are faster and less error-prone.
Better Cargo Protection
Professional forwarders pack consolidated goods properly to avoid damage.
Streamlined Supply Chain for SMEs
Small businesses save both time and money, focusing on sales instead of shipping headaches.
Types of Freight Consolidation in China
LCL (Less than Container Load) Consolidation
Goods from multiple importers are combined into one container, splitting costs.
Air Freight Consolidation
Forwarders consolidate lightweight parcels into bulk air cargo shipments, lowering courier costs.
Amazon FBA Consolidation Services
Forwarders consolidate goods and prepare them with FBA labeling and packaging before delivery to Amazon warehouses.
Cost & Transit Time Comparison – Consolidation vs Direct Shipping
| Shipping Method | Average Transit Time | Cost Efficiency |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Direct LCL Shipping | 30–40 days (sea) | Higher per CBM | Importers with single supplier |
| Consolidated LCL | 30–40 days (sea) | 20–30% cheaper | Multiple suppliers, SMEs |
| Direct Air Freight | 5–9 days | Higher per kg | Urgent cargo |
| Consolidated Air Freight | 6–10 days | 15–25% cheaper | E-commerce shipments |

Freight Consolidation Process – Step by Step
- Pickup – Forwarder collects goods from multiple suppliers.
- Warehousing – Goods are stored and inspected in a consolidation warehouse in China.
- Packaging – Repacking or palletizing for protection.
- Customs Documentation – One Bill of Lading prepared.
- Shipment – Cargo loaded into sea, air, or rail freight.
- Destination Handling – Forwarder clears customs and delivers goods to final address.
Common Challenges in Freight Consolidation
- Delays if one supplier is late.
- Risk of poor packaging if forwarder is inexperienced.
- Customs misclassification when goods are diverse.
- Hidden fees if forwarder lacks transparency.
How to Choose a Reliable China Freight Forwarder for Consolidation
- Warehouse Network – Ensure they have consolidation hubs in Shenzhen, Yiwu, Guangzhou, Shanghai.
- Customs Expertise – Must handle multi-supplier documentation.
- Transparent Pricing – Clear per CBM or per kg charges.
- Amazon FBA Experience – If selling online, choose a forwarder with FBA prep service.
- Technology – Online tracking for consolidated shipments.

FAQ
Q1: Can I consolidate goods from suppliers in different Chinese cities?
Yes, forwarders can arrange pickups nationwide and consolidate them in one central warehouse.
Q2: Is consolidation available for both air and sea freight?
Yes. While sea freight consolidation is most common, many forwarders now provide air freight consolidation for small e-commerce parcels.
Q3: Do I need to pay customs duties separately for each supplier’s goods?
No. Consolidation creates one set of customs documents, making clearance easier and cheaper.
Q4: Can I consolidate trial orders before mass production?
Yes, consolidation is an excellent option for sample orders or small trial runs from multiple factories.
Q5: Does consolidation increase risk of cargo damage?
Not if handled by professionals. Forwarders ensure goods are packed securely in pallets or crates.
Q6: Is freight consolidation suitable for temperature-sensitive goods?
Yes, but you must request cold-chain consolidation warehouses in advance.
Q7: Can I use freight consolidation for Amazon FBA shipments?
Yes, forwarders consolidate and prepare goods with FBA packaging and deliver directly to Amazon warehouses.
